Dermalux therapy consists of exposing the skin to low-level light energy from the visible and infrared parts of the spectrum. Choosing the right wavelength depends on the chromophore being targeted, and the desired photobiological process. Selective wavelengths interact with biological systems and activate key cell receptors, resulting in a transformation of the chromophore through a transfer of light energy to cellular energy.

Common questions

What is doctor-led planning?

It is a consultation-led approach where your goals, medical history, suitability, treatment options, recovery and aftercare are reviewed before a plan is confirmed.

How much is a consultation?

Doctor, nurse and qualified-practitioner consultations are free. A £50 kiosk booking deposit secures the appointment. The deposit is shown before payment. The booking journey shows the applicable cancellation and rescheduling terms before you confirm.

Can I book without knowing which treatment I need?

Yes. You can start with a consultation and the team will guide you through suitable options for your skin, face, body or hair goals.

Are results guaranteed?

No. Results vary between individuals. Your clinician will explain realistic expectations, risks, downtime and maintenance before treatment.
